Public fields

aar_tbl

AAR results.

statistics_tbl

AAR test statistic results.

Methods


Method new()

Class initialization

Usage

AARResults$new(aar_tbl, statistics_tbl)

Arguments

aar_tbl

AAR result table.

statistics_tbl

Table with statistics.


Method print()

Print key characteristics.

Usage

AARResults$print()


Method plot()

Plots AAR results for each analysis group.

Usage

AARResults$plot(
  group = NULL,
  ci_statistics = NULL,
  p = 0.95,
  ci_type = "two-sided",
  xlab = "Event Window",
  ylab = "Averaged Abnormal Returns",
  facet = T,
  ncol = 4
)

Arguments

group

Subset to your analysed groups, else all groups will be plotted.

ci_statistics

Statistic used for confidence intervals

p

The desired p-value

ci_type

type of CI band for ggplot2, available are band or ribbon.

xlab

x-axis label

ylab

y-axis label

facet

should each group get its own plot (default = T)

ncol

number of facet columns


Method plot_cumulative()

Plot Cumulative Abnormal Return. No test statistic is available.

Usage

AARResults$plot_cumulative(
  xlab = "Event Window",
  ylab = "Cumulative Averaged Abnormal Returns",
  facet = T,
  ncol = 4
)

Arguments

xlab

x axis lab

ylab

y axis lab

facet

Shall the plot faceted by Group

ncol

Number of cols when faceting.


Method confidence_interval()

Calculates Confidence band for given test statistic.

Usage

AARResults$confidence_interval(
  statistic = "Patell Z",
  p = 0.95,
  ci_type = "two-sided"
)

Arguments

statistic

Chosen test statistics for calculation.

p

Chosen p value.

ci_type

Type of confidence interval.


Method plot_test_statistics()

Plots a heatmap with test statistics on y axis and Day Relative to Event on x axis. Colorization is done according to significance according to given p.

Usage

AARResults$plot_test_statistics(p = 0.95, ci_type = "two-sided")

Arguments

p

Chosen p value.

ci_type

CI type.


Method clone()

The objects of this class are cloneable with this method.

Usage

AARResults$clone(deep = FALSE)

Arguments

deep

Whether to make a deep clone.

Method plot()

Plot abnormal returns in the event window of single or multiple firms.

Usage

ARResults$plot(firm = NULL, xlab = "", ylab = "Abnormal Returns", addAAR = F)

Arguments

firm

set this parameter if just a subset of firms should be plotted

xlab

x-axis label of the plot

ylab

y-axis label

addAAR

add aar line

Returns

a ggplot2 object
